President Muhammadu Buhari has approved support to Guinea Bissau’s election process including 350 units of electoral kits, 10 motorcycles, five Hilux vans, two light trucks and Five hundred thousand US Dollars ($500,000).

The approval was in response to an urgent request for assistance by the Government of Guinea Bissau.

According to Garba Shehu Senior Special Assistant to the President (Media & Publicity) the assistance is to ensure that legislative elections held in Guinea Bissau, which he said, should help in stabilizing the country.

Also, in his capacity as Chairman of the ECOWAS Authority of Heads of State, President Buhari on Friday, directed the Minister of Foreign Affairs, Geoffrey Onyeama to undertake an urgent mission as his Special Envoy to Guinea Bissau, in the company of ECOWAS Commission President, Jean-Claude Brou.

In a separate development, Nigeria’s Foreign Minister will also undertake a mission to Cotonou, Benin, to deliver a personal message to President Patrice Talon from President Buhari.

The visit is in the context of the brewing political crisis ahead of April 28, 2019, legislative elections in the country.
